I'm finding that there is confusion as to when the mobile menu displays, when the non-mobile menu displays, and when neither or both display. I'm using the accordeon menu and the accordeon mobile extensions. To test the display I use various mobile emulators, as well as resizing my desktop screen window.

I'm using the accordeon menus in the widescreen version as a sidebar. The template I'm using the layout changes at "min-width 768px". I have the accordeon mobile plugin limit set to 767.999. (Setting to 767 and 768 is even more confused, and sometimes the mobile bar will show at the bottom of the non-mobile menu.)

When the window width is set to:
767px:
- mobile bar displays across width of screen (correct)
- non-mobile menu does not display (correct)

768px:
- mobile bar displays in sidebar (incorrect)
- non-mobile menu does not display (incorrect)

769px:
- non-mobile menu displays (correct)
- mobile does not (correct)

Please help me figure out how to get this to work. I would have thought that the mobile plugin would automatically disable the non-mobile menu when the mobile menu kicks in, but that's not always the case. If I suppress the mobile bar at 768px via CSS, then I get a blank space where the non-mobile menu should be in the sidebar.
